ASP进阶:客户端开发实战全攻略
|
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代Web开发中已逐渐被更先进的框架所取代,但其核心概念和编程思想仍然具有参考价值。对于希望深入理解Web开发机制的开发者来说,掌握ASP进阶内容能够帮助他们更好地理解动态网页生成的过程。
本效果图由AI生成,仅供参考 在客户端开发中,ASP主要用于生成HTML内容并发送到浏览器。为了提升用户体验,开发者需要结合JavaScript、CSS等前端技术,实现更丰富的交互效果。例如,通过ASP生成动态表单数据后,再利用JavaScript进行验证或异步请求,可以显著提高页面响应速度。实际开发中,需要注意ASP与客户端脚本的协作方式。ASP代码在服务器端执行,生成最终的HTML内容,而JavaScript则在浏览器端运行。因此,合理设计前后端的数据传递方式至关重要。可以通过隐藏字段、AJAX请求或者JSON格式的数据交换来实现高效的通信。 安全性也是不可忽视的方面。ASP页面可能面临跨站脚本攻击(XSS)或SQL注入等风险,因此在处理用户输入时必须进行严格的过滤和转义。同时,客户端脚本也需防范恶意代码的注入,确保整个系统的安全稳定。 实践是掌握ASP进阶技能的关键。通过构建完整的项目,如用户登录系统、动态内容展示等,可以加深对ASP与客户端技术整合的理解。不断调试和优化代码,有助于提升开发效率和代码质量。 (编辑:PHP编程网 - 金华站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330481号